So far we have had a good experience, it's a bit pricey but you definitely get a lot for what you pay. She likes it a lot, they offer everything. They have a pool and a tennis court, they have a clinic in each building. They are fantastic. The whole atmosphere is really nice, they have a chapel for all religions. They have a memory care building, I popped in just to see what it was like, and there are no odors, and it's just like an apartment building but they get more one on one care. No matter how sick you get or if you end up needing to move there, the price stays the same, it is all inclusive. The people that work there were the most important thing to me, and they have been very, very nice. They let my mom come and help her get settled in and she said there wasn't one mean face there, and not just the workers but the residents too. Everyone is just very happy. I just wish they serviced Kaiser a bit more, but they have been great about working with us on that. If I had my wish list it would be nice for the food to be a bit more seasoned, and the shuttle is a bit limited, and scheduled. But those are just minor "if I could have my wish list" things. I have no regrets! This place is great.

It was well organized, clean (actually smelled good and not in a covering-up-bad-odors way), and the staff were professional. It is a nice size. I did not see anyone who looked neglected. The grounds are lovely. It is quiet, yet there is activity. Having a SNF across the way is a bonus. The marketing woman who showed me around (Kirstin) was the only one who got it about "conversational dementia" (her phrase) - someone who can appear perfectly normal even though they have major deficits. It had a very different feel than any other place I have been. I would definitely move my father in here if it comes down to it.

St. John's is a beautiful facility. It feels very much like a small college campus. The whole property is very open and airy. My dad spends the majority of his time sitting outside. It's quite tranquil. My father's room is modest, but perfectly suited for his needs. He has a large set of windows that open up onto the court yard. Had we the pick of any room in the complex, I don't think we could have chosen better. The staff is wonderful, kind, and caring. The facility is minutes from Downtown, South Park, West Adams, and USC. I can cycle there for a visit in about 10 minutes. My brother and I feel very lucky to have found this spot for our father. His health and happiness have improved immensely since he moved in.
